Net Zero, Energy and Transport Committee

Tuesday 08 March 2022 9:30 AM

1. Decision on taking business in private: The Committee will decide whether to take items 5 and 6 in private. 2. Subordinate legislation: The Committee will take evidence on the National Bus Travel Concession Schemes (Miscellaneous Amendments) (Scotland) Order 2022 [draft] from— Jenny Gilruth, Minister for Transport, and Heather Auld, Solicitor, Scottish Government; Tom Davy, Head of Bus Strategy and Concessions Policy, and Debbie Walker, Business and Operations Manager, Transport Scotland. 3. Subordinate legislation: Jenny Gilruth (Minister for Transport) to move—S6M-02903—That the Net Zero, Energy and Transport Committee recommends that the National Bus Travel Concession Schemes (Miscellaneous Amendments) (Scotland) Order 2022 [draft] be approved. 4. Transfer of operation of ScotRail: The Committee will take evidence from— Michael Clark, Programme Director, Strategy and Transformation, Great British Railways Transition Team; Mick Hogg, Regional Organiser, RMT (The National Union of Rail, Maritime and Transport Workers); Robert Samson, Senior Stakeholder Manager, Transport Focus. 5. Transfer of operation of ScotRail: The Committee will consider the evidence it heard earlier under agenda item 4. 6. Work programme: The Committee will consider its work programme.
